-Quality Assurance
-=================
-
-* `Link to Sonar Report <https://jenkins.opendaylight.org/releng/view/packetcable/job/packetcable-sonar>`_ ( Test coverage percent - 53.21% )
-* Link to CSIT Jobs:
-
-  * https://jenkins.opendaylight.org/releng/view/packetcable/job/packetcable-csit-1node-pcmm-only-carbon
-  * https://jenkins.opendaylight.org/releng/view/packetcable/job/packetcable-csit-1node-pcmm-all-carbon
-
-* Other manual testing and QA information - While the CSIT jobs run the
-  PacketCable plugin against a simple "emulated" instance of a CMTS network
-  device, the code is frequently tested during the development cycle against
-  actual CMTS devices.
-* Testing methodology. There is substantial unit testing associated with the
-  project build process and CSIT testing is executed against an "emulated" CMTS
-  device.  All product APIs are validated during the development cycle but CSIT
-  testing has not been upgraded to cover some of the most recent feature
-  additions that are incorporated in the Carbon release.

-Migration
----------
-
-* Is it possible to migrate from the previous release?  Yes
-* Migration from PacketCable Boron version to Carbon version can be
-  accomplished by replacement of the PacketCable plugin components.
-
-  * Any data stored in COPS models will need to be manually copied over.
-
-* All previous API calls will work with the new release.

-Standards
-=========
-
-* CableLabs "PacketCable 1.5 Specification: MTA Device Provisioning"
-  PKT-SP-PROV1.5-I04-090624
-  The Packetcable plug-in implements a subset of the provisioning operations
-  defined in this specification.
